Output 51709815d6b54f10deef403f7d44621767fda4307b3eefe77443a83a7c463c35:0

value
4153858
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 04aac824c320ff63cb1577fd20e8379134764971 OP_EQUALVERIFY OP_CHECKSIG
address
1RgHtwi8gWzExEwyj9us9x126iDrSu7zT
transaction
51709815d6b54f10deef403f7d44621767fda4307b3eefe77443a83a7c463c35
spent
true